My thoughts, new meter can and service riser, new 40 space 200 amp panel inside the garage directly behind the new meter.
I would open the wall up 4' wide or so from floor to ceiling to make mounting the panel easy and to make it easy to run new wire to the attic.
Pull all the circuits that go up into the attic at the existing panel up into the attic and into junction boxes, run new wire back to new panel in garage.
If my count is right I see 16 single pole circuits and 3 two pole so a bit of wire to run but not that bad.
If you have circuits that go down or sideways in the wall it will add some challenge to the job, a junction box low on the wall(plug height) in the living room would be much better then having an entire panel to hide.
Doing it this way would also get you plenty of power in the garage which I think was the original plan.

A bunch of 4x4 boxes and covers, mostly mounted in a row somewhere in the attic, in a place where you disconnect a wire from the old panel, pull it up in the attic and throw it over to the 4x4 box. Make a splice in the box and continue with new 12-2 NM to the new panel. Do the next one, and the next, and there will be a few odd ones that require different placement of the splice box.
I dont think the weather head and the phone and cable wires are separated far enough to meet current code, so you simply move down the wall and put in the new one. If well planned, the change over would be a fairly painless affair.
The OP can easily find a 90 amp or 100 amp breaker for the panel he has, its what is now a Murray, owned by Siemens and shares components with Siemens. Siemens breakers are approved for use in Murray panels.
